ICS840-75 75MHZ, LVCMOS/LVTTL OSCILLATOR REPLACEMENT PRELIMINARY GENERAL DESCRIPTION The ICS840-75 is a SAS/SATA Oscillator Replacement and a member of the HiPerClocksTM family of high performance devices from ICS. The ICS840-75 uses a 25MHz crystal to synthesize 75MHz. The ICS840-75 has excellent jitter performance. The ICS840-75 is packaged in a small 8-pin TSSOP, making it ideal for use in systems with limited board space.
FEATURES
- One LVCMOS/LVTTL output, 15Ω output impedence
- Crystal oscillator interface designed for 25MHz, 18pF parallel resonant crystal
- Output frequency: 75MHz
- Random jitter: 3ps (typical)
- Deterministic jitter: 0.14ps (typical)
- 3.3V operating supply
- 0°C to 70°C ambient operating temperature
